General Engineering is the 96th most popular major in the country with 9,018 degrees awarded in 2020-2021.

Across the Southeast region, there were 1,996 general engineering gra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the associate degree level specifically, there were 560 general engineering graduates with average earnings and debt of $34,328 and $20,384 respectively.

This year’s “Schools for an Associate Highly Focused on Engineering Major in the Southeast Region” ranking analyzed 28 colleges that offered a degree in general engineering. The colleges and universities that top this list are recognized because their general engineering program is one of the largest majors offered at the school.
